CAS 305381-05-9
:2-Piperazin-1-Ylpyridine-4-Carbonitrile
Description:
2-Piperazin-1-ylpyridine-4-carbonitrile is a chemical compound characterized by its unique structure, which includes a piperazine ring and a pyridine moiety, along with a cyano group. This compound typically exhibits properties associated with heterocyclic compounds, such as moderate solubility in polar solvents and potential for forming hydrogen bonds due to the presence of nitrogen atoms in both the piperazine and pyridine rings. It may display biological activity, making it of interest in medicinal chemistry, particularly in the development of pharmaceuticals. The cyano group contributes to its reactivity, allowing for further chemical modifications. Additionally, the compound's molecular structure suggests potential interactions with biological targets, which can be explored in drug discovery processes. As with many nitrogen-containing heterocycles, it may also exhibit basicity, influencing its behavior in various chemical environments. Overall, 2-Piperazin-1-ylpyridine-4-carbonitrile is a versatile compound with potential applications in various fields, including medicinal chemistry and material science.
Formula:C10 H12 N4
